Another trend is the rise of boutique festivals, which cater to niche audiences by offering bespoke experiences. Portland's Pickathon, for instance, has grown a dedicated following by marrying sustainability with an eclectic lineup that stretches across rock, folk, and experimental sounds. This blending of environmental consciousness with musical exploration offers a different kind of festival experience—one that is intimate but full of surprises.

On the opposite end of the spectrum, large-scale events like Glastonbury are honing technology to enhance the audience experience. The implementation of augmented reality displays and immersive sound design is not only heightening the live aspect but also setting a new standard for future festivals. The expectation is that these technologies will eventually become commonplace, thus influencing how live music is consumed worldwide.

But it’s not just the music—the festival experience as a whole is evolving. With the introduction of wellness areas that focus on mental and physical health, festivals are beginning to offer holistic experiences to their patrons. These spaces serve as a retreat from the chaos, offering yoga sessions, meditation retreats, and even eco-friendly workshops. It's a testament to how festivals are conscientiously adapting to the needs of modern audiences, providing more than just music.
